§ 28A.335.150 — Permitting use and rental of playgrounds, athletic fields or athletic facilities.

Text

Boards of directors of school districts are hereby authorized to permit the use of, and to rent school playgrounds, athletic fields, or athletic facilities, by, or to, any person or corporation for any athletic contests or athletic purposes. Permission to use and/or rent said school playgrounds, athletic fields, or athletic facilities shall be for such compensation and under such terms as regulations of the board of directors adopted from time to time so provide.

Legislative History

[1969 ex.s. c 223 s 28A.58.048. Prior: (i)1935 c 99 s 1; Rem. Supp. s4776-1. Formerly RCW28.58.048. (ii)1935 c 99 s 2; RRS s 4776-2. Formerly RCW28A.58.048,28.58.050.]
